What's new
Panelica Community Forum

Welcome to the official Panelica Community Forum — the central hub for server administrators, developers, and hosting professionals. Register a free account today to access technical discussions, product announcements, feature requests, and direct support from the Panelica team. Be part of the growing community shaping the future of server management.

WordPress & Applications — Feature Overview

Status
Not open for further replies.

admin

Administrator
Staff member
WordPress, Laravel, Node.js & Git Deploy — Full Feature Overview​

Panelica provides enterprise-grade application management with dedicated toolkits for WordPress, Laravel, Node.js, plus a full Git-based CI/CD deployment system.

WordPress Toolkit (8 Pages)​

Comprehensive WordPress lifecycle management with WP-CLI integration.

Installations — List all WP sites with status badges, one-click admin auto-login (SSO), freeze/unfreeze (security lock), fix permissions, change admin password, uninstall. Quick stats: active, frozen, issues.

Install — Multi-step wizard. Target: existing domain, new domain, subdomain, or import. Configure: site title, admin credentials, PHP version, locale, auto-update settings, blog visibility. Pre-flight checks.

Plugins — Two tabs: Installed (per-site management, filter active/inactive/needs-update, individual and bulk actions) and Plugin Store (search WordPress.org, popular categories, install to single or multiple sites, batch operations across all installations).

Themes — Browse, search, preview, per-site activation.

Updates — Unified dashboard: core, plugins, themes, translations. Multi-site batch updates.

Backup — WP-specific: Full, Database-only, Files-only. Per-site history, restore capability.

Staging — Create staging environments (staging.domain.com). Sync files (rsync) and/or database. Push to production with typed confirmation. Selective sync and rollback.

Security — Core/plugin integrity check, malware scanning (ClamAV), suspicious files, PHP-in-uploads detection. Hardening score (0-100). Login monitoring with IP threat intelligence. Activity timeline.

Laravel Management (8 Pages)​

Projects — Dashboard with project cards: version, PHP, status, DB info, queue/cache stats, disk usage.

Artisan — Execute artisan commands (migrate, seed, queue:work, cache:clear), command templates, output viewer.

Deploy — Deployment strategies: Zero-downtime, Blue-green, Canary, Rolling. History, rollback, logs.

Environment — .env file editor. Queues — Driver, workers, jobs, failed recovery. Scheduler — Task scheduling, execution history. Logs — Real-time streaming, filtering, download.

Node.js Management (6 Pages)​

Applications — Cards showing: name, domain, port, status (running/stopped/error/crashed), CPU/memory, uptime. Process manager: PM2, Forever, Systemd, Nodemon.

Create — Framework selection (Express, Next.js, Fastify, Socket.io), entry point, port, process manager, instance scaling.

PM2 Manager — Process list, memory/CPU stats, restart/stop/delete, live monit.

NPM Packages — Install/update/remove, version selection, security vulnerability scanning.

Environment — Variables editor with encryption. Logs — Real-time streaming, error filtering, log rotation.

Git Deploy (Unified Manager)​

Comprehensive Git repository and CI/CD system at /git/manager.

Overview — Stats (repos, deployments, pipelines, quota), recent activity, OAuth connections (GitHub/GitLab/Bitbucket).

Repositories — Create from GitHub/GitLab/Bitbucket (OAuth), custom URL (SSH/HTTP/token), or local. Cards showing name, URL, branch, status, last commit.

Repository Detail (7 Tabs):
  • Branches — List, create, delete, checkout, protection indicators
  • Commits — Log per branch, GitHub-style diff viewer with syntax highlighting
  • Files — Tree browser, CodeMirror viewer (20+ languages), dark mode
  • Deployments — History (pending/building/deploying/success/failed/cancelled/rolled back), real-time logs, trigger, cancel, rollback
  • Environments — Production/staging/dev/custom, deploy target, env vars, pre/post commands, health checks
  • Pipelines — CI/CD editor: sequential steps (build/test/lint/deploy/notify), per-step vars, manual run
  • Deploy Keys & Webhooks — SSH keys, GitHub/GitLab webhook config, event filtering, auto-deploy triggers

Global Deployments — All deployments across all repos with filtering, logs, cancel, rollback.

Settings — OAuth management, Git status, storage quota, feature permissions (custom paths, checkout, diff, download, env vars).

Sidebar Navigation​

  • WordPress — Installations, Install, Themes, Plugins, Updates, Backup, Staging, Security
  • Laravel — Projects, Create, Artisan, Deploy, Environment, Queues, Scheduler, Logs
  • Node.js — Applications, Create, PM2 Manager, NPM Packages, Environment, Logs
  • Git & Deploy — Git Manager (unified page with tabs)

Access Control​

  • WordPress — License-gated (enterprise), per-plan page permissions
  • Git Deploy — Feature permissions: custom paths, checkout, diff, download, env vars
  • Laravel / Node.js — Permission-based via page permissions
  • All — ROOT full access, ADMIN/RESELLER manage for their users, USER manages own apps

If you encounter any issues with this feature, please open a report in the Bug Reports forum.

Related Topics​


---
For issues with this feature, please report in the Bug Reports forum.
 
Last edited:
Status
Not open for further replies.
Back
Top